Re: Difficult to select node; parameter setting possible?

You can increase the vertex size and the pick radius in the preferences. Thanks chrisb. :D Version: 0.19.22522 (Git) Pick radius: Edit >> Preferences >> Display >> Colors >> Pick radius (px) Vertex size: Edit >> Preferences >> Part design >> Shape appearance >> Vertex size Sometimes I also work wit...
